A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you and your family if you've been diagnosed with asbestos-related illnesses. These illnesses are caused from asbestos exposure. Asbestos is a dangerous mineral, which was used in many industries from the 19th century. It is durable, cheap, and fire resistant. It was also used as an ingredient in insulation and building materials. Unfortunately, mesothelioma or other diseases related to asbestos can be fatal.

An experienced asbestos lawyer can guide you through the legal maze. They can also assist you to understand your rights and get the compensation you're entitled to. They can help cover medical bills, lost wages and other expenses. They can assist with travel expenses, and even home health care if required.

Asbestos lawyers can also help you discover possible sources of exposure that could cause your condition. They can help you find asbestos-contaminated work sites, as well as identify the responsible asbestos companies. These lawyers can help you with filing lawsuits and claims and negotiate mesothelioma agreement, and present your case in the courtroom. They are committed to obtaining victims the justice they deserve.

Inform the authorities immediately if you suspect you've been exposed to asbestos. This will ensure that you are qualified for workers' compensation and the company that was accountable can be held accountable for the injury. It is also important to keep in mind that New York State Law requires you to inform your employer of any illness or injury that you have suffered at work or injury within 30 days.

New York Asbestos Lawyers

New York is one of the nation's most active areas for asbestos litigation. Each year, hundreds of asbestos lawsuits in New York are filed. These lawsuits are usually filed by people suffering from asbestos-related illnesses, such as mesothelioma or other asbestos-related diseases. These lawsuits are often brought against companies that exposed workers to asbestos at work. A mesothelioma attorney can help those suffering from mesothelioma, as well as their families, seek compensation for their loss.

The mesothelioma lawyers at the firm Weitz & Luxenberg helped dozens clients in New York get compensation for their losses. They work on a contingency basis, which means they don't receive any money unless they obtain an award or settlement for their client. The attorneys are familiar with federal asbestos laws and New York statutes. They are also well-versed in the various types of mesothelioma lawsuits that need to be filed.

In the New York region alone, thousands of people have been identified as mesothelioma patients. A lot of these patients have been exposed to asbestos in the construction industry, shipyards, auto manufacturing and in other fields. Those who have developed an asbestos-related disease often have to undergo extensive medical treatments. The compensation from a mesothelioma lawsuit can be used to cover these treatments.

An asbestos lawyer can help you file a claims for workers compensation claim, a personal injury lawsuit or a wrongful death suit. Workers' compensation may seem like a sensible option if the exposure to asbestos occurred at the workplace, but workers' comp benefits usually do not pay for the entire cost of the losses suffered by a victim.

Mesothelioma patients in New York should contact a mesothelioma lawyer firm that will provide free consultations and representation for their case. During the meeting, an attorney will explain to the patient what legal claims are available and answer any questions they might have. The lawyer will also explain the statute of limitations that is the period within which they can file an action. In the state of New York, this is usually three years from date of diagnosis or two years from the date of a loved one's death.
